Going into high school can be tough for anyone, especially Tracy Anderson-Hummel. Trying to stay a normal teen with two dads who are famous Broadway actors is definitely a challenge she has to learn to accept. Between joining the glee club her fathers helped put on the map, and crushing on the principals kid, this road doesn't look like it is going to be easy. Good thing Tracy has got the stories her dads tell her about their crazy life to help guide her through the intense world of high school.
